titleOfInvention Compositions useful in the diagnostic of latently infected Mycobacterium tuberculosis
abstract The present invention concerns a composition comprising at least three peptides derived from Mycobacterium tuberculosis antigen Rv2626c, its use in the diagnostic of latently infected Mycobacterium tuberculosis (LTBI) subjects, corresponding methods of use and kits.
